This is the Ölüdeniz trailhead of the Lycian Way, Turkey's most famous long-distance path (roughly 540 km on to Antalya). You don't need to walk far — twenty minutes up the coastal path toward Faralya and you're looking straight down onto the lagoon and the whole sweep of the bay, completely free. Go early morning or late afternoon for the light and to dodge the midday heat. Even a short out-and-back is one of the best views in the resort; proper shoes and water if you push on further.
